The limited participation of women in political and decision-making processes poses a serious challenge to democracy, since over 50% of the citizenry is de facto excluded from public affairs. Thus, the interests of this excluded group, namely of women, cannot be adequately represented in decision-making processes.

Web11 de mai. de 2024 · Balanced participation means that each team member joins the discussion when his or her contribution is pertinent to the team assignment. It also means that everyone's opinions are sought and valued by others on the team. Participation is everyone's responsibility. As a team moves from a forming stage to more mature stages …

WebAt the most basic level, participation means people being involved in decisions that affect their lives. Through participation people can identify opportunities and strategies for action, and build solidarity to effect change. Participation matters as a core value in open and democratic societies, and increasingly is recognised as a ‘right ...
